Can you travel abroad while being treated with Herceptin?

Hiya,
I’m 32 and was diagnosed with breast cancer in April and I had surgery to remove the lump in May. There were clear margins and no node involvment. The lump was grade 2 and HER2 positive. I have been told I will need chemo, radio and herceptin. I’m currently waiting for my appt with the oncologist to discuss everything and find out when my treatment starts. Obviously, I’ve lots of thoughts/questions about what’s to come, but I need to know about travelling. My sister is planning on getting married in Majorca next June, when my chemo and radio will be over, but I’ll still be mid Herceptin. Will I be able to travel abroad while that treatment is ongoing?
Thanks in advance.

Hi

Yes, you can travel on herceptin.I am due to go to Spain this summer, by then it will be herceptin number 12 for me and have already planned this in with the herceptin nurse ( I get mine at home) they can jiggle the days around a bit to accommodate you. Just make sure your insurance company know.
